For the 2025-26 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 987 students in Reading, MA (there are , serving 4,038 public students). 20% of all K-12 students in Reading, MA are educated in private schools (compared to the MA state average of 12%).
The top ranked private school in Reading, MA is Austin Preparatory School.
The average acceptance rate is 58%, which is lower than the Massachusetts private school average acceptance rate of 71%.
33% of private schools in Reading, MA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ic).
